Unexpectedly, these calls keep showing up with the same playbook: bogus virus removal fees, fake Verizon staff, and pressure to hand over personal data. The pattern points to a classic tech support scam that exploits brand names to gain trust. If your phone rings, let the call go to voicemail before deciding to call back. Never share credit‑card numbers or passwords, and double‑check any claim by contacting the official company through its website or official app. Use your carrier’s call‑blocking tools, and report the number to the FTC or the National Do Not Call Registry. Staying skeptical cuts the risk.
